Gro-beta Recombinant Protein has been tested by biological activity and is suitable as a control for polyclonal or monoclonal anti-Gro-beta in immunological assays.
Bioactivity of Human Gro-beta (CXCL2) Recombinant Protein. Triplicate samples of primary human neutrophils from three donors were allowed to migrate to Human GRO-beta/CXCL2 (10, 100 and 1000 ng/mL). After 30 minutes, cells that migrated were counted using a luminescent substrate and displayed on the bar graph above. Significant levels of migration over basal were seen in response to Human GRO-beta/CXCL2 starting at 10 ng/mL.
